#36560f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#36560f is composed of 21.2% red, 33.7% green and 5.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 37.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 82.6% yellow and 66.3% black. It has a hue angle of 87 degrees, a saturation of 70.3% and a lightness of 19.8%. #36560f color hex could be obtained by blending #6cac1e with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

#36560f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#36560f has RGB values of R:54, G:86, B:15 and CMYK values of C:0.37, M:0, Y:0.83, K:0.66. Its decimal value is 3560975.
